Looking to leave CBBE behind on my next playthrough and move finally fully over to AB Physics. I have experimented with AB a bit with the Bodyslide I picked out. 

 

Problem is some of my favorite outfit sets like ASA and a few undergarment mods have yet to be converted. Is there a way I can convert them myself? If so how?

Just check out the Outfit Studio tutorials.

What you then need is a conversion reference from CBBE to AB, probably included in the AB mod.

 

The process is quite mechanical and repetitive, you load a CBBE outfit and then the conversion reference. Conform to sliders, morph from CBBE to AB and set this as new baseshape. Then  load AB as new reference, delete the CBBE body where applicable, conform to AB sliders and fix each of them with the in/deflate brushes. Save project and repeat for all other outfits.

 

Main problem with AB is that its shape varies too much from CBBE, so the conversions are looking quite shabby unless you improve them in Blender first.
